首页
社区
课程
招聘
[讨论]修改路由器bin固件,给固件添加功能,可以做到么?
发表于: 2018-5-24 12:05 28580

[讨论]修改路由器bin固件,给固件添加功能,可以做到么?

2018-5-24 12:05
28580
收藏
免费 0
支持
分享
最新回复 (12)
雪    币: 199
活跃值: (58)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
2
你说的不就是firmware modify kit吗?完全可以做到
2018-7-5 10:07
0
雪    币: 131
活跃值: (415)
能力值: ( LV2,RANK:15 )
在线值:
发帖
回帖
粉丝
3
附议一楼
FMT完全可以把固件修改之后打包回去,如果目标没有对固件进行签名校验的话,可以用设备自带的固件升级功能写进去。
2018-7-5 16:49
0
雪    币: 181
活跃值: (154)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
4
回复3楼,我也需要修改光猫固件
2018-8-6 13:28
0
雪    币: 11
活跃值: (12)
能力值: ( LV5,RANK:70 )
在线值:
发帖
回帖
粉丝
5
如果能用binwalk成功识别的(包括固件头、kernel、文件系统等),可以使用FMK进行修改然后再重打包。如果固件加密了,则需要先对固件进行解密(可以通过分析设备上一些负责升级的程序)。如果是自定义的固件,用binwalk识别有困难的,如果能够进入设备拿到一些二进制程序,同样可以对负责升级的程序进行分析,搞清楚固件的大概格式,再进行修改并重打包。如果在线升级过程有RSA签名校验的估计不好搞,如果只是简单校验文件的散列值,应该可以绕过。
2018-8-7 21:16
0
雪    币: 8
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
6
firmware modify kit 怎么用,报一堆错误
2018-9-5 10:00
1
雪    币: 44
活跃值: (64)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
7
如果是已知的openwrt这种应该是可以的。
2018-9-5 11:10
0
雪    币: 0
能力值: ( LV1,RANK:0 )
在线值:
发帖
回帖
粉丝
8
firmware modify kit 怎们用,我最近也报了一堆错误
2019-11-26 17:23
0
雪    币: 2375
活跃值: (433)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
9
云来雾去 如果是已知的openwrt这种应该是可以的。
有些路由器固件没法用这个工具修改么?
2019-11-29 23:58
0
雪    币: 2375
活跃值: (433)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
10
john——lods firmware modify kit 怎们用,我最近也报了一堆错误
你改的哪个固件呀
2019-11-29 23:58
0
雪    币: 221
能力值: ( LV1,RANK:0 )
在线值:
发帖
回帖
粉丝
11
可以啊,把文件系统解出来再打回去,有检验的话把校验过了.
2020-7-13 19:47
0
雪    币: 201
活跃值: (182)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
12
firmware modify kit需要对个别功能升级
2020-9-1 17:29
0
雪    币: 1260
活跃值: (2168)
能力值: ( LV5,RANK:75 )
在线值:
发帖
回帖
粉丝
13

抽取固件,为啥会出现这个错误

2020-9-1 19:35
0
游客
登录 | 注册 方可回帖
返回
//